    CVE-2025-36041 – IBM MQ Operator Private Key Configuration Vulnerability

    June 15, 2025

    CVE ID : CVE-2025-36041

    Published : June 15, 2025, 1:15 p.m. | 12 hours, 6 minutes ago

    Description : IBM MQ Operator LTS 2.0.0 through 2.0.29, MQ Operator CD 3.0.0, 3.0.1, 3.1.0 through 3.1.3, 3.3.0, 3.4.0, 3.4.1, 3.5.0, 3.5.1 through 3.5.3, and MQ Operator SC2 3.2.0 through 3.2.12 Native HA CRR could be configured with a private key and chain other than the intended key which could disclose sensitive information or allow the attacker to perform unauthorized actions.

    Severity: 4.7 | MEDIUM
